TPS92515HV: Question about output current

Part Number: TPS92515HV

Hello,

Made TPS92515HV circuit as attached Webench design to get 1.64A output, but measured output current is 1.84A not 1.64A.

Could you let me know why output current is different from Webench design?

And how can make it to get 1.64A output current?

  • Hello Nicky,

    The calculated values are good, but this device usually needs some small amount of adjustments when you get it on the bench since it is a peak current detect rather than regulating average current.

    That said there are 3 ways of adjusting the average output current easily and you can do one or more, whichever is easiest:

    1. You could reduce the IADJ voltage a bit until the average current is correct.

    2. You could adjust Roff1 until the average is correct. I higher Roff1 value will lower the switching frequency which increases the inductor ripple. Increasing the ripple will lower the average output current.

    3. You could change the inductor value. Same as above, if you lower the L value the ripple will increase and average current will reduce.
